Drury University vs. BYUH Cost Comparison

Which college is more expensive, Drury University or BYUH?

  • Drury University is 420% more expensive to attend than BYUH for in-state tuition ($32,500.00 vs. $6,250.00)
  • Out of state tuition is 420% higher at Drury University than Brigham Young University Hawaii ($32,500.00 vs. $6,250.00)
  • The typical actual cost that students pay to attend (average net price) is less at Brigham Young University Hawaii than Drury University ($15,835 vs. $20,996)
  • Living costs (room and board or off-campus housing budget) at Brigham Young University Hawaii are 15.9% lower than costs at Drury University ($8,828 vs. $10,232)
  • More students receive financial grant aid at Drury University than Brigham Young University Hawaii (100% vs. 67%)
  • The average total grant financial aid received by Drury University students is 344.2% larger than aid received Brigham Young University Hawaii ($24,535 vs. $5,523)

Drury University vs. BYUH Admissions Difficulty Comparison

Which college is harder to get into, Drury University or BYUH? Average SAT and ACT scores plus acceptance rates offer good insight into the difficulty of admission between BYUH or Drury University .

  • The average SAT score at Drury University (1185) is 87 points higher than at BYUH (1098)
  • Incoming Drury University students have a 2 point higher average ACT score (26) than students at BYUH (24)
  • Accepted freshman Drury University students have a 0.32 point higher average high school GPA (3.79) than students at BYUH (3.47)
  • Drury University has a higher acceptance rate (63.4%) than BYUH (34.2%)

Drury University vs. BYUH Graduation Outcomes Comparison

Which is better, Drury University or BYUH? Graduation rate, salary and amount of student loan debt are indicators of a college which offers better outcomes for its graduates. Compare the following outcomes facts between BYUH and Drury University.

  • The graduation rate at Drury University is higher than Brigham Young University Hawaii (53% vs. 51%)
  • Graduates from Brigham Young University Hawaii earn on average $12,900 more per year than Drury University graduates after ten years. ($48,300 vs. $35,400)
  • Brigham Young University Hawaii students graduate with a $15,382 lower median federal student loan debt than Drury University graduates. ($8,759 vs. $24,141)
  • BYUH graduates are paying $159 less per month on federal student loans than Drury University graduates. ($90 vs. $249)
  • More BYUH graduates are actively paying back their federal student loan debt than former Drury University students, three years after graduation. (71% vs. 50%)
